Loving Others: Models of Collaboration

LOVING OTHERS - Models of collaboration is appearing on the occasion of the same-named exhibition at the Künstlerhaus Wien. The exhibition-curated by Christian Helbock und Dietmar Schwärzler-aims to help make artist groups and their different collaborative models and forms of social bonding and solidarity be productive, as well as to tell stories of constructive failure. The exhibition sees itself as an experimental field for observing and comparing collectives, artist groups, and even temporary collaborations in a differentiated and engaging way. The publication, which is not intended as an exhibition catalogue, accompanies the show. It collects and presents discursive texts on the topic, additional material, further contributions by artists, and accompanying interviews. The publication is an independent, discursive collection of material and provides in-depth information on various forms of collaboration, individual groups or artistic practices for an interested audience.

Experimental Film and Photochemical Practices

  • Categories: Art

This book assesses the contemporary status of photochemical film practice against a backdrop of technological transition and obsolescence. It argues for the continued relevance of material engagement for opening up alternative ways of seeing and sensing the world. Questioning narratives of replacement and notions of fetishism and nostalgia, the book sketches out the contours of a photochemical renaissance driven by collective passion, creative resistance and artistic reinvention. Celluloid processes continue to play a key role in the evolution of experimental film aesthetics and this book takes a personal journey into the work of several key contemporary film artists. It provides fresh insight into the communities and infrastructures that sustain this vibrant field and mobilises a wide range of theoretical perspectives drawn from media archaeology, new materialism, ecocriticism and social ecology.

Friedl Kubelka Vom Gröller

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2013
  • -
  • Publisher: Jrp Ringier

This publication offers a retrospective of the work of photographer and filmmaker Friedl Kubelka (born 1946)--known as a filmmaker under the name of Friedl vom Gröller. It gathers her portraits of filmmaker friends and family, film stills and a selection of her fashion photographs. In 1972 she began her epic project Year's Portraits, for which she photographed herself daily over a period of one year--a process that has been repeated every five years since. Among the artist's portrait subjects are Franz West, Walter Pichler and Peter Kubelka (her husband), as well as central protagonists of the American Independent Cinema such as Jack Smith, Bruce Conner, Hollis Frampton, Kenneth Anger, Jonas Mekas, George and Mike Kuchar, and many more. Most of the images gathered together here are published for the first time in book form. The book also includes a DVD with a selection of vom Gröller's 16 mm films.

Friedl Kubelka Vom Gröller: One Is Not Enough

The heart of filmmaker Friedl vom Gröller is constituted by portraiture ? whether she captures friends, acquaintances, family members, filmmakers, artists or simply clients, each for the most part gazing directly into the camera. Since 1972 to the present, Kubelka has also placed herself in front of the camera for her project 'Jahresportraits' (Yearly Portraits) in which she mercilessly documents the process of aging. It has become the structural credo of Kubelka?s artistic practice to juxtapose the individual photograph with many other photographs.0The monograph focuses upon individual serial works as combined with contemporary portrait series showing e.g. artists from Senegal which are combined with others from Kubelka?s archive. So as to multiply perspectives, individual portraits are juxtaposed with others (double portraits), or more. As extras a journal about the mural painter Pape Mamadou Samb aka Papisto Boy and a DVD with a selection of films of the artist are attached to the book.

The Art of Resistance

Well before the far-right resurgence that has most recently transformed European politics, Austria’s 1999 parliamentary elections surprised the world with the unexpected success of the Freedom Party of Austria and its charismatic leader, Jörg Haider. The party’s perceived xenophobia, isolationism, and unabashed nationalism in turn inspired a massive protest movement that expressed opposition not only through street protests but also in novels, plays, films, and music. Through careful readings of this varied cultural output, The Art of Resistance traces the aesthetic styles and strategies deployed during this time, providing critical context for understanding modern Austrian history as well as the European protest movements of today.
